Residential Construction Superintendent Designation

The Home Builders Institutes’ Residential Construction Superintendent (RCS) Designation coursework enhances the knowledge and skills of home building or remodeling site field professionals.

Industry subject matter experts designed the courses offered through the RCS Designation, which includes the original RCS Designation, Advanced RCS Designation and RCS specialty concentrations in log and timber home building and concrete technologies.

Students who successfully complete the eight RCS Designation courses will have the foundational knowledge of a job-ready superintendent, from project management to working with trade contractors to planning and scheduling to customer relations.

Students who have earned the original RCS designation can expand their knowledge with the Advanced RCS Designation, which prepares them for residential construction supervisory roles. Advanced RCS Designation courses cover three areas of study: Professional Growth, Building Leaders and Technical Proficiency. A test-out option for the Advanced RCS designation is available. 

HBI also offers RCS specialty designations in concrete home building and log and timber frame construction to experienced home builders and superintendents. HBI partnered with NAHB’s Concrete Home Building Coalition (CHBC) on concrete home building courses that provide students with the knowledge they need to successfully manage residential construction sites that use concrete materials.

Subject matter experts from NAHB’s Log Homes Council developed the Log and Timber Frame Home Construction Overview to familiarize students with the intricacies of log home construction. Because the craft of constructing a log home is different than traditional construction, construction professionals can benefit greatly from an indepth look at building log homes through this one four-hour course.

Since students have different learning styles and varying schedules, HBI offers RCS designation courses in both online, through a partnership with Viridis Learning, and in a classroom setting with an HBI-approved instructor through local home builders associations nationwide. Online courses are available in both English and Spanish.
